Ngmoco leads mobile nominations in first GDC Online Awards

The nominations for the first annual Game Developers Choice Online Awards have a distinctly mobile flavour to them, with publisher ngmoco - together with developers Newtoy and Wonderland - set to tussle it out with PC and console developers in almost every category.
Set up as part of the GDC Online conference to be held in October, the new awards look to honour studios behind the best online titles, handing out accolades for titles with the best design, technical elements and community relations, amongst others.

Leading the mobile charge is ngmoco, with We Rule, developed by US outfit Newtoy and Godfinger, from UK studio Wonderland, collectively picking up four nominations in terms of best design, art, game and audio.
Booyah's Nightclub City currently available on Facebook is also up for three awards, while both Playfish and Zynga are nominated for two awards with social games FIFA Superstar and Farmville respectively.
Also nominated is Digital Chocolate, which is up for best social network game along with rivals Booyah, Playfish, Playdom and Zynga for NanoStar Siege.

"The world of online gaming has expanded and evolved massively in just a few years, and those creators who have pushed the category forward deserve to be recognised for their creations," said Simon Carless, global brand director for UBM.
"We're delighted to have set up the Game Developers Choice Online Awards to recognise these talented, sometimes underappreciated developers and honor the social past, present and future of the game industry."
The winners will be announced on October 7 as part of GDC Online 2010 in Austin.
